        &lt;p&gt;NEW YORK &amp;mdash; A self-described celebrity stalker admitted Thursday to harassing Ivanka Trump by barraging her and her husband with bizarre tweets, emails and online videos.&lt;/p&gt;

&lt;p&gt;Justin Massler, who for months had been deemed psychologically unfit for trial, pleaded guilty Thursday to aggravated harassment and criminal contempt charges. He was sentenced to six months jail time that he had already served, plus five years of probation, during which he must continue psychiatric treatment and medication.&lt;/p&gt;
        &lt;p&gt;The Manhattan district attorney's office said Massler unleashed a slate of emails and tweets about his fixation with the NBC "Celebrity Apprentice" co-host, whose parents are Donald and Ivana Trump.&lt;/p&gt;

&lt;p&gt;Massler said his "dream in life" was to marry Ivanka Trump, but at times his remarks turned more ominous, prosecutors said. He threatened to commit suicide in her Manhattan jewelry store and said he wanted to "talk some sense into" her husband, Jared Kushner, and "commandeer" the newspaper that Kushner publishes, The New York Observer, prosecutors said.&lt;/p&gt;

&lt;p&gt;"I won't just be ignored," Massler wrote in an August email to the newspaper, according to a court complaint.&lt;/p&gt;

&lt;p&gt;Massler, who is in his late 20s, also has said he would die before being caught and "would go down in a hail of gunfire," prosecutors said. Even after his arrest and a court order to stay away from Ivanka Trump and her family, Massler continued to try to contact them, prosecutors said.&lt;/p&gt;

&lt;p&gt;The Reno., Nev.-based Massler &amp;ndash; who had his name legally changed to Cloud Starchaser and told authorities his address was "a volcano in Hawaii" &amp;ndash; is schizophrenic and has a history of psychiatric hospitalizations, said his lawyer, George Vomvolakis.&lt;/p&gt;

&lt;p&gt;Massler was declared unfit about eight months ago to participate in court proceedings, but doctors concluded about three weeks ago that his mental state had improved enough under medication for him to return to court.&lt;/p&gt;

&lt;p&gt;"When he's on his medication, he's fine. He's lucid, he's reasonable," Vomvolakis said.&lt;/p&gt;

&lt;p&gt;Representatives for Trump, who is also a vice president at her father's real estate company, had no immediate comment.&lt;/p&gt;

        &lt;p&gt;Stars: they're just us! Even they think the Oscars are boring.&lt;/p&gt;

&lt;p&gt;&lt;a href="http://www.maxim.com/tv/interview-with-dustin-hoffman" target="_hplink"&gt;In a new interview with &lt;em&gt;Maxim&lt;/em&gt;&lt;/a&gt;, two-time Academy Award winner Dustin Hoffman says what you've been thinking for years.&lt;/p&gt;

&lt;p&gt;"It's boring!" he said, when asked about attending the ceremony. "It lasts forever, and don't think you're seeing spontaneous behavior. You see couples who are suddenly smooching, and, well, there's a guy sitting on the ground with the camera at their knees."&lt;/p&gt;

&lt;p&gt;Hoffman claims he once wanted to play with that lack of spontaneity, but was persuaded to play nice. &lt;/p&gt;

&lt;p&gt;"There was one particular time I knew I wasn't going to win, and when they'd train the camera on me as one of the losers, I wanted to be able to rip open my tuxedo shirt and just have stenciled on my chest, oh, shit," &lt;a href="http://www.maxim.com/tv/interview-with-dustin-hoffman" target="_hplink"&gt;he said&lt;/a&gt;. "But my wife wouldn't let me do it."&lt;/p&gt;

&lt;p&gt;&lt;a href="http://www.imdb.com/name/nm0000163/awards" target="_hplink"&gt;Hoffman has been nominated seven times in the Best Actor category&lt;/a&gt;, most recently for "Wag the Dog" in 1997. He previously won for "Kramer Vs. Kramer" (1979) and "Rain Man" (1988).&lt;/p&gt;

&lt;p&gt;The star's disdain for the Oscars was apparent even when he won for "Kramer Vs. Kramer" at the 1980 ceremony.&lt;/p&gt;

&lt;p&gt;"He has no genitalia and he's holding a sword," &lt;a href="http://www.youtube.com/watch?v=EhDmNRQgKLM" target="_hplink"&gt;Hoffman quipped upon receiving his Oscar&lt;/a&gt;, before adding, "I'd like thank my parents for not practicing birth control."&lt;/p&gt;

&lt;p&gt;Hoffman can now be seen weekly on the HBO series "Luck." Wonder what he'll say about the Emmy Awards...&lt;/p&gt;

LOS ANGELES â Mary J. Blige brought out plenty of emotion as she performed in front of a packed house to support one of her favorite charities.&lt;/p&gt;

&lt;p&gt;Blige sang several of her most famous songs including "No More Drama" and "Family Affair" at the Avalon nightclub on Thursday night to support the (RED) campaign that raises money to fight AIDS and HIV. She has supported the charity for years.&lt;/p&gt;

&lt;p&gt;The singer gave a few emotional speeches where she talked about the importance of giving back.&lt;/p&gt;

&lt;p&gt;"All those people we are rocking for are going to be just fine," Blige said before performing her hit single "Just Fine."&lt;/p&gt;

&lt;p&gt;After her set, musician Skrillex acted as DJ, playing in a VIP area at the Belvedere-sponsored pre-Grammy event that also included singer Kelis, actress Malin Akerman and Oscar winner Forest Whitaker.&lt;/p&gt;

&lt;p&gt;The Grammys will be held Sunday at the Staples Center in Los Angeles.&lt;/p&gt;

        &lt;p&gt;Movies: Now more (expensive) than ever. According to the National Association of Theater Owners (&lt;a href="http://www.hollywoodreporter.com/news/movie-ticket-prices-increase-2011-288569" target="_hplink"&gt;via The Hollywood Reporter&lt;/a&gt;), movie ticket prices reached an all-time high last year, rising from $7.89 in 2010 to $7.93 in 2011. Thankfully for consumers, the increase wasn't as bad as the previous year, &lt;a href="http://latimesblogs.latimes.com/entertainmentnewsbuzz/2011/01/movie-ticket-prices-reach-new-milestone.html" target="_hplink"&gt;which saw ticket prices grow $0.39 between 2009 and 2010&lt;/a&gt;.&lt;/p&gt;

&lt;p&gt;What's to blame for the increasing cost of attending the movies -- y'know, besides the increasing cost of everything, ever? Think of it as a trickle-down issue: studios are producing more and more blockbusters, which cost more and more money (see the budgets of "&lt;a href="http://www.newyorker.com/reporting/2011/10/17/111017fa_fact_friend" target="_hplink"&gt;John Carter&lt;/a&gt;" and "&lt;a href="http://www.deadline.com/2012/02/battleship-recruits-50m-in-promotional-partnerships-universals-big-bet-paying-off/" target="_hplink"&gt;Battleship&lt;/a&gt;" for examples); exhibitors are upgrading to digital projection and, often times, require 3D projectors to screen the blockbusters; and consumers are getting left with at least some of the bill. 3D tickets cost, on average, $3 more than regular tickets.&lt;/p&gt;

&lt;p&gt;That's not to say all hope is lost: ticket prices dropped to $7.83 in the fourth quarter of 2011, which could mean a leveling off in 2012; after all, ticket prices have grown in every year since 1992.&lt;/p&gt;

&lt;p&gt;Perhaps that lower national average at the end of the year is helping business: since the ball dropped on 2012, movie attendance has been in an upswing, and many early year releases have done better than anticipated at the box office.&lt;/p&gt;
